Valley Marathon Canceled After Sponsor Pulls Out
- Share via
The inaugural San Fernando Valley Marathon, scheduled for next month, has been canceled, race director Bill Lovelace said Thursday.
Lovelace said the event was put in jeopardy when its major sponsor, Prince Manufacturing Co. of Princeton, N.J., decided to pull out. He said an alternate sponsor could not be found to provide the majority of the $40,000 budget.
The race, which was being billed as the first marathon run completely in the Valley, was scheduled for Nov. 17.
Lovelace said that Basin Blues, an Encino-based running club that was organizing the marathon, plans to try again next year.
